Scotland's National Record of the Historic Environment records Aultbea Church as Church (early 20th Century). The official map says its point is accurate as follows: NGR given to the nearest 1m. The record does not by itself mean that the public may enter the place.
Aultbea Church is associated with Saint Becca, a 6th-century Irish missionary and one of the early Christian saints of the Scottish Highlands. Traditionally linked to healing and protection, the church and surrounding area may have once been a site of pilgrimage, though specific local folklore or recorded cures connected to the site are sparse in historical records.
